Abstract

Young coconut coir (Cocos nucifera Linn.) waste has the potential to be processed into a useful product, namely as a source of natural dyes, especially in cotton fabrics. Processing is carried out through a maceration process for 72 hours using 96% ethanol as solvent. The obtained extract was applied on cotton cloth with various concentrations of the extract solution, 5, 10, 15, 20, and 25%, and various soaking times of the fabric in the extract for 60, 90, 120, 150, and 180 minutes. The extract was analyzed using Uv-Vis Spekctrofotometer it showed that the ethanol extract or dye that is absorbed into the cotton fabric with various concentrations is 3.43, 4.82, 6.61, 7.79, and 9.03%, respectively. The various soaking times show that on the other hand that the extract absorbed into the fabric was successfully obtained around 7.75, 9.64, 10.81, 11.65, and 12.04%. The results show that the concentration of the extract solution and the increasing length of soaking time can increase the percentage of extract or dye absorbed in cotton fabrics
